Description
The Human Resources Generalist assists the Employee Relations Manager with employee relation matters with a focus on ensuring compliance with company policies, employment laws, and regulations across our multi-state organization. This role conducts comprehensive investigations of workforce conflicts and grievances, supports employee training and development and the full employee life cycle. 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S
- Work with all levels of management to mentor and coach through employee relation matters.
- Perform exit interviews.
- Within range of knowledge, answer questions concerning state and federal labor laws.
- Perform complex and sensitive workplace investigations ensuring thorough and objective processes, findings, and conclusions are met.
- Provide recommendations on appropriate correction actions, discipline, or policy changes following investigations.
- Provide guidance and support to managers and employees on various issues, such as grievances, disputes, disciplinary actions, layoffs, and terminations.
- Collaborate with Legal and leadership to resolve employee relations issues while ensuring consistency and fairness.
- Ensure consistent application of company policies and procedures throughout organization.
- Draft and execute disciplinary letters and investigation reports.
- Stay current with federal, state, and local employment laws, including - specific employment regulations such as CFRA, PAGA and wage and hour laws to ensure organizational compliance.
- Maintain a high level of confidentiality and professionalism when handling sensitive information.
- Assist employees with Leaves of Absence.
